Workers of Samanoud for Wool and Weaving Company will be paid their September salaries and will receive LE10 million in shares to invest in the factory, manpower minister Kamal Abu Eitta announced on Monday.
Payments will be drawn from the company's emergency aid fund, the board decided on 14 November.
Workers will be granted LE10 million in shares to use in loan payments and operation of stalled production lines, Abu Eitta elaborated.
On Saturday, security forces forcibly dispersed a sit-in by Samanoud workers after they blocked railway lines connecting Tanta to Mansoura.
The workers had been on strike for three weeks, demanding payment of their base salaries.
A committee headed by the industry minister will study the feasibility of raising the company's capital by LE121 million.
